A mystery that I've been trying to solve for a couple of years now: When I was in choir in high school, we sang a medley arrangement of The Water is Wide, and another song, with a tune very similar to The Riddle Song (I Gave My Love A Cherry), except with very different lyrics. Every time I've tried to figure out where these two songs might've branched from each other I've come up pretty short. I thought I might share the lyrics here and see if anyone else is familiar with it?

Lyrics are as follows:

my love gave me a diamond, a diamond ring
my love gave me a song, that angels sing
my love gave me a rose, of crimson hue
my love gave me a promise, a heart so true

As you can probably tell, it features a similar structure to the riddle song, but instead of the singer giving, they're receiving, and there's no riddle to the gifts.
